Output ddd52c4d4b7798f0c597c6dfad78dc367124364d0f7eb8cac706cb8830567273:1

value
23945295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f3890abe3b29730f422bae2cc394f597e505c0f OP_EQUAL
address
335VpdmsajdLzhufn9WUo5aYo5dn5FuTJZ
transaction
ddd52c4d4b7798f0c597c6dfad78dc367124364d0f7eb8cac706cb8830567273
spent
true